Key Measurement Metrics for Non-Profit Capacity Building Grants

Funding for capacity building in emerging non-profits is heavily reliant on stringent measurement metrics to evaluate effectiveness. Unlike general operating grants, this funding focuses on strengthening organizational capabilities to address community needs effectively. This type of program does not support direct service delivery, instead prioritizing administrative and operational enhancements that allow organizations to function more efficiently.

Non-profits must establish clear benchmarks related to organizational governance, program development, and financial practices. Common Key Performance Indicators (KPIs) include metrics related to board diversity and engagement, funding diversification rates, and participant satisfaction scores on services provided. Tracking these metrics is essential for demonstrating the organization’s growth and effectiveness over time.

In addition to setting KPIs, non-profits must fulfill specific evaluation and reporting requirements associated with their funding. This often includes regular progress updates and comprehensive reports that detail the impact of capacity-building activities on organizational performance. Organizations should be prepared to present qualitative and quantitative data that aligns with their stated outcomes.

Performance thresholds pose additional challenges, as organizations are often required to meet specific targets to maintain eligibility for ongoing funding. Programs falling short of these benchmarks face the risk of losing financial support, underscoring the importance of rigorous planning and assessment practices within the organization.
